HOME REMODELING AND RENOVATION
HOME REMODELING AND RENOVATION SERVICES STEP BY STEP PLANNING
Initial Consultation: The first step in any home remodeling or renovation project is an initial consultation with a professional contractor. During this meeting, you will discuss your goals, budget, and design ideas, and the contractor will assess the scope of the project and provide an estimate.
Design and Planning: Once you have agreed on the scope of the project, the next step is to create a detailed design plan and obtain necessary permits. This may involve working with an architect or designer to create drawings and specifications, and submitting these to the local building department for approval.
Preparing the Space: Before the renovation can begin, the contractor will prepare the space by removing any furniture, covering the floors and walls, and installing protective barriers. This will help ensure the safety of your home and the workers during the renovation process.
Demolition: In many cases, the first step in a home renovation project will be to remove any existing fixtures, walls, or other elements that are no longer needed or desired. This may involve demolition of part or all of the existing space, and the removal of debris.
Structural Work: After the demolition is complete, the next step is to make any structural changes or additions to the space. This may involve adding walls, installing new beams, or making other modifications to the existing structure.
Plumbing and Electrical: Once the structural work is complete, the next step is to install any new plumbing and electrical systems. This may involve running new pipes, installing electrical outlets and fixtures, and making any other necessary upgrades.
Framing and Drywall: After the plumbing and electrical work is done, the contractor will begin installing new walls, ceilings, and other components. This may involve installing insulation, hanging drywall, and preparing the surfaces for painting or wallpapering.
Finishing Work: After the walls and ceilings are complete, the next step is to install any final finishes, such as trim, molding, and cabinetry. This may also involve installing flooring, tiling, or other decorative elements.
Painting and Decorating: Once the finishing work is complete, the final step is to paint or decorate the space according to your specifications. This may involve selecting colors, wall coverings, and other decorative elements, and applying them to the walls and ceilings.
Clean-Up and Final Inspection: After the project is complete, the contractor will clean up the site and perform a final inspection to ensure that everything is in order. Once the inspection is complete and all necessary permits have been obtained, you will be able to move into your newly renovated space. More Idea and tips
The steps involved in a home remodeling and renovation project may vary based on the scope and complexity of the project, and may also be impacted by local building codes and regulations. 1. What is Asphalt Sealcoating?
Sealcoating is a protective layer applied to the surface of asphalt. It’s typically made from a mixture of liquid asphalt, sand, water, and special additives. This sealant acts as a barrier between your driveway and the elements—sun, rain, snow, and chemicals—that can cause damage over time.
Think of sealcoating like sunscreen for your driveway. Just as sunscreen protects your skin from harmful UV rays, sealcoating shields your asphalt from the sun, water, and everyday wear and tear. It also helps fill small cracks and prevent them from expanding into larger issues.
2. Why Do Asphalt Driveways Crack?
Asphalt driveways are durable, but they aren’t immune to damage. Over time, various factors can cause cracks to develop in the surface, including:
Weather Exposure: The sun’s UV rays can dry out asphalt, causing it to become brittle and crack. In colder climates, freezing and thawing cycles can cause asphalt to expand and contract, leading to cracks.
Water Damage: Water can seep into tiny cracks in the asphalt, eroding the base and causing further damage. If left untreated, these small cracks can turn into larger ones or even potholes.
Heavy Traffic: Driveways that experience frequent use by vehicles can become worn down over time, leading to cracks and surface wear.
Chemical Spills: Oil, gasoline, and other automotive fluids can soften asphalt, making it more susceptible to damage.
Without proper maintenance, these cracks can worsen and reduce the lifespan of your driveway. That’s where sealcoating comes in.
3. The Benefits of Asphalt Sealcoating for Homeowners
Sealcoating is more than just a cosmetic treatment for your driveway—it offers several practical benefits that make it a must for homeowners looking to protect their investment.
1. Protects Against Weather Damage
Asphalt driveways are constantly exposed to harsh weather conditions. In summer, the sun’s UV rays can cause the asphalt to dry out, leading to cracks and fading. In winter, freezing temperatures and moisture can cause the asphalt to expand and contract, which weakens the surface.
Sealcoating creates a protective barrier that shields the asphalt from the sun’s harmful rays and prevents water from penetrating the surface. This helps reduce the risk of cracks caused by weather exposure.
2. Extends the Life of Your Driveway
A properly maintained asphalt driveway can last 20 years or more. However, without regular care, cracks and potholes can develop, shortening its lifespan. Sealcoating helps extend the life of your driveway by preventing small cracks from expanding and by sealing the surface against water, oil, and other damaging substances.
By investing in sealcoating every two to three years, you can protect your driveway from premature wear and keep it in excellent condition for decades.
3. Saves You Money on Repairs
Cracks, potholes, and other damage to your driveway can be costly to repair. The good news is that regular sealcoating can prevent these issues from occurring in the first place. By sealing small cracks and protecting the surface from the elements, sealcoating helps you avoid expensive repairs down the line.
Think of sealcoating as an affordable way to maintain your driveway and protect your investment. It’s much cheaper than resurfacing or replacing a damaged driveway.
4. Enhances Curb Appeal
A well-maintained driveway is essential for maintaining the overall appearance of your home. Over time, asphalt can lose its rich black color and become faded or gray. Sealcoating restores the deep black finish of your driveway, making it look like new again.
If you’re planning to sell your home in the future, a freshly sealcoated driveway can also enhance curb appeal and potentially increase property value. A smooth, black surface creates a strong first impression for potential buyers.
5. Provides a Smoother Surface
Over time, asphalt can become rough and uneven due to wear and tear. Sealcoating fills in small cracks and imperfections, creating a smoother surface for vehicles and pedestrians. This not only improves the appearance of your driveway but also enhances safety by reducing the risk of tripping or falling on uneven surfaces.
4. How Sealcoating Works
The process of sealcoating is relatively simple, but it requires the right tools and expertise to ensure a smooth, even application. Here’s an overview of how sealcoating works:
Cleaning the Surface: Before sealcoating can begin, the driveway must be thoroughly cleaned. This involves removing dirt, debris, and any oil or grease stains that could prevent the sealcoat from adhering properly.
Filling Cracks and Potholes: Any existing cracks or potholes in the asphalt should be filled and repaired before sealcoating. This ensures a smooth surface and prevents further damage.
Applying the Sealcoat: The sealcoat mixture is applied evenly across the surface of the driveway using a squeegee or spray. The sealant is spread in thin layers to ensure complete coverage.
Allowing Time to Cure: Once the sealcoat is applied, it needs time to cure and dry. This typically takes between 24 and 48 hours, depending on weather conditions.
For professional sealcoating services, it’s best to work with an experienced contractor who can ensure a quality application. Learn more about our Sealcoating Services.
5. How Often Should You Sealcoat Your Driveway?
The frequency of sealcoating depends on several factors, including the climate in your area and how much traffic your driveway experiences. In general, it’s recommended to sealcoat your driveway every two to three years to maintain optimal protection.
If you notice any signs of damage, such as fading, cracks, or rough surfaces, it may be time for a fresh sealcoat. Regular inspections can help you stay on top of maintenance and prevent issues from getting worse.

WHAT IS SEALCOATING AND WHY SHOULD YOU DO IT?
Sealcoat is a protective layer applied to asphalt driveways. It's typically made from petroleum asphalt, sand, and additives. When applied correctly, sealcoat offers a multitude of benefits:
Protects Against the Elements: Sealcoat acts as a barrier against snow and water, sun damage (oxidation), and oil spills. This helps to prevent cracks, potholes, and overall deterioration of your driveway.
Enhances Curb Appeal: A freshly sealcoated driveway has a rich black appearance that instantly makes your home look more polished and cared for.
Extends the Lifespan of Your Driveway: Sealcoating can significantly extend the lifespan of your asphalt driveway, potentially saving you money on repairs and replacements down the road.
WHAT IS AN OVERLAY AND ITS BENEFITS:
Asphalt overlays offer a budget-friendly alternative to complete driveway replacements. This process involves applying a new layer of asphalt over your existing driveway, creating a smooth, fresh surface. Overlays not only improve curb appeal for potential buyers, but also extend the lifespan of your driveway by protecting it from cracks, water damage, and sun degradation. They're a quick and cost-effective way to breathe new life into your asphalt and potentially increase your home's value.
Cost-effective: Save money compared to a full driveway replacement.
Improved Curb Appeal: Boost the attractiveness of your property.
Extended Lifespan: Protect your driveway from cracks, water damage, and sun.
Fast & Easy: Minimize disruption with a quicker installation process.

Different types of asphalt damage require specific repair methods:
Crack Filling: Small cracks are filled with asphalt emulsion or hot pour crack filler to prevent water infiltration and further damage.
Pothole Repair: Potholes are filled with hot mix asphalt or cold patch asphalt, with cold patch serving as a temporary solution until hot mix asphalt can be applied for a more permanent fix.
Resurfacing: For significant damage or fading, resurfacing involves adding a new layer of asphalt on top of the existing surface.
The frequency of asphalt repair depends on factors such as pavement age, weather conditions, traffic volume, and maintenance practices. While newly constructed surfaces may require repairs every 3-5 years on average, older surfaces or those subjected to heavy traffic or harsh weather may need more frequent attention.

Types of Asphalt Cracks We Repair
Cracks generally fall into two categories: working and non-working.
Non-Working Cracks – These are either vertical or diagonal and extend into the asphalt without any noticeable movement. Unlike working cracks, they don’t expand or contract with temperature shifts, making them easier to fix. Non-working cracks are often caused by temperature fluctuations, traffic, or poor drainage.
Working Cracks – These cracks, whether vertical or horizontal, tend to shift with changes in temperature. Traffic and inadequate drainage can also contribute to these active cracks, which require a more involved repair process due to their movement.
